Output 3704becaeeebc0ea30ad22991a046276079a7c28eb313443ecfeec878e546ae7:0

value
1086059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26e819dea3373012e709c15d08778d960b424f0 OP_EQUAL
address
3LsgCwZhpAEBgJJWhe6gkUbouyL2NuZSxj
transaction
3704becaeeebc0ea30ad22991a046276079a7c28eb313443ecfeec878e546ae7
spent
true